As part of the 16 Days of Activism on Ending Gender Based Violence Against Women, Every8Minutes collaborated with Missing and 10 partner NGOs across India, to run the National Campaign on child trafficking from 25 November to 10 December 2015
Missing is a public art project started by Leena Kejriwal, a photographer and an installation artist. Missing works with local NGOs, students, artists and volunteers to create an everyday reminder of the missing girls.
Using art for activism, NGOs working on anti-child trafficking and education in eight cities across India painted silhouettes of young girls using the hashtag #Every8minutes and #missingirls in vulnerable areas. Street plays, drawing, painting and slogan writing competitions, discussion on child trafficking were some of the activities held during the campaign. We provided child helpline number 1098 and contact details of local NGOs working on child trafficking to local communities so that if they see any child in danger or a child has gone missing, they may immediately contact them and seek help.
The campaign provided a platform to reach out to local communities to spread awareness about child trafficking and how hundreds of girls and young women go missing everyday in India.
During a public rally held in Delhi, a woman approached us to help her find her 4 and half-year-old daughter, who has been missing for the past two weeks. Every8Minutes, along with our partner organisation took the details from the missing girl’s family and immediately filed a case at the local police station.
